Cranbrook (Devon) is a modest station, focusing on providing essential services to its passengers. Though it lacks a ticket office, there are reliable ticket machines available for purchase and collection of tickets bought online, offering full accessibility to all users. The station is fully equipped with an induction loop system, ensuring ease of use for those with hearing impairments. While there are no waiting rooms or seating areas, the station does provide step-free access across all platforms, with ramps facilitating easy boarding for all.
While waiting for your train, public WiFi is available to keep you connected. However, the lack of on-site refreshments, shops, and restrooms suggests coming prepared with your travel essentials. CCTV surveillance is active, promoting a secure environment throughout your journey.

At Five Ways, ticket purchasing is seamless with the ticket office open from 7: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ays, slightly adjusted hours on weekends, and ticket machines ready for quick service. For those collecting online tickets, easy-access ticket machines are available. While there's an absence of smartcards, other amenities, like CCTV and customer help points ensure a secure and informed experience for passengers.
Accessibility is prioritized at this station, classifying it as a step-free access category A station—guaranteeing effortless movement across all platforms. While the assistance meeting point is normally at the ticket office, if unmanned, conductors on platforms provide support. Despite the absence of sheltered cycle storage and car parking, the station compensates with ramps for train access and accessible toilet facilities.
